Según la definición de la Wikipedia AJAX es un acrónimo de Asynchronous JavaScript And XML (JavaScript y XML asíncronos) siendo una una técnica de desarrollo web para crear aplicaciones interactivas. Éstas se ejecutan en el cliente, es decir, en el navegador del usuario, y mantiene comunicación asíncrona con el servidor en segundo plano.
El termino de Ajax fue acuñado por Jesse James Garrett, fundador de la consultora Adaptive Path, en el año 2005 y experto en usabilidad. Garret utilizo este termino para agrupar toda una serie de tecnologías que se venían ya utilizando en la arquitectura de sitios y servicios web, como el DHTML, creado por Microsoft, XHTML -sucesor del actual HTML- las hojas de estilo en cascada (CSS) y JavaScript. Además incorporo a estas técnicas otras mucho más modernas como son el XMLHttpRequest o XSLT. http://www.xajaxproject.org/ |